PECAN TASSIES | |
1/2 c. butter, softened 1 (3 oz.) pkg. cream cheese, softened 1 c. all-purpose flour 1 egg 3/4 c. packed brown sugar 1 tbsp. butter, softened 1 tsp. vanilla Dash salt 1/2 c. chopped pecans For pastry, in mixing bowl cream together the 1/2 cup butter and softened cream cheese. Stir in flour; mix well. Cover. Chill mixture about 1 hour. In small mixing bowl, stir together egg, brown sugar, the 1 tablespoons butter, vanilla and salt just until smooth; set aside. Shape chilled pastry dough into two dozen 1" balls, place each ball in ungreased 1 3/4" muffin cup. Press dough onto bottom and sides of cups. Spoon about 1 teaspoon of the chopped pecans into each pastry lined muffin cup. Fill each with egg mixture. Bake at 325 degrees for about 25 minutes or until filling is set. Cool, remove from pans. Cover. Makes 24. |
